What is an EV Charger?
An EV charger, also known as an electric vehicle supply equipment (EVSE), is a device that delivers electrical energy from a power source to an electric vehicle. It allows EV owners to recharge their car’s battery either at home, work, or at public charging stations. Depending on the type and power level, an EV charger can charge a vehicle in a few hours or overnight.

How Do EV Chargers Work?
EV chargers draw electricity from the grid and convert it into a form suitable for the car’s battery. Level 1 and Level 2 chargers provide alternating current (AC) power, which the car’s onboard charger then converts to direct current (DC). DC fast chargers skip this conversion by delivering DC power directly to the battery, allowing for much faster charging.
